Fish the man made structures. Dam , riprap , bridges and causeways, old road beds and railroad tracks, especially where they cross the old river and creek channels .

audigger53 wrote:
Without watching, get a Lake Map and look for drop offs and structure. Bass like to hide from the other fish so they can strike at them from any kind of cover.
The edge of a drop off, brush, pier pilings, or other structure.
You can also use a Fish Finder but first look at the map for drop offs and then for structure. Just my 2 cents worth.

Drop offs are structure . Brush and pier pilings are cover .
